COVID-19: Railways introduces new coaches with ionised AC air, copper-coated handles

Surat: Amid the rising cases of corona virus afflictions in India, the Indian Railways has introduced fresh features in new coaches, including foot-operated soap dispensers and toilet flushes, new door handles and handrails coated with anti-microbial copper to make the passenger’s journey and life safer. Introducing “Panchamrit”, Amul offers a new product in devotional domain

Introducing a new product category, Amul added a food item for the gods, just a week ago. The dairy brand launched Panchamrit, a food traditionally served as ‘prasad’ after puja at temples.  However, the ingredients of Panchamrit vary across geographies in India, the most popular blend is of honey, sugar, curd, cow milk, and ghee.
